Output e95bf9b91c09a00bbf45eb7c8b6a45bf9dce6254edb74913fc962ea329d41583:1

value
2143565
script pubkey
OP_0 OP_PUSHBYTES_20 3de17bddececd5aeddbeea47cf0acbeddc3944e2
address
bc1q8hshhh0van26ahd7afru7zktahwrj38z8hx4x7
transaction
e95bf9b91c09a00bbf45eb7c8b6a45bf9dce6254edb74913fc962ea329d41583
confirmations
45954
spent
true